High Protein Banana Blueberry Bake (Printable)

A hearty, protein-rich breakfast bake combining sweet bananas, juicy blueberries, and wholesome oats for a satisfying morning meal.

# What You Need:

→ Wet Ingredients

01 - 2 large ripe bananas, mashed
02 - 2 large eggs
03 - 1 cup unsweetened Greek yogurt
04 - 1/3 cup honey or pure maple syrup
05 - 1 cup unsweetened almond milk
06 - 1 tsp vanilla extract

→ Dry Ingredients

07 - 2 cups old-fashioned rolled oats
08 - 1/2 cup vanilla or plain protein powder
09 - 1 1/2 tsp baking powder
10 - 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
11 - 1/4 tsp salt

→ Fruit

12 - 1 1/2 cups fresh or frozen blueberries

→ Optional Toppings

13 - 1/4 cup chopped walnuts or almonds
14 - 1 tbsp chia seeds

# How To Make It:

01 - Preheat the oven to 350°F. Lightly grease a 9x9 inch baking dish with cooking spray or butter.
02 - In a large bowl, whisk together the mashed bananas, eggs, Greek yogurt, honey, almond milk, and vanilla extract until completely smooth and combined.
03 - In a separate medium bowl, mix the rolled oats, protein powder,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t until evenly distributed.
04 - Pour the dry ingredients into the wet mixture. Stir gently with a spatula until just combined, being careful not to overmix.
05 - Gently fold in the blueberries, taking care not to crush them.
06 -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ish, spreading evenly. Sprinkle chopped nuts and chia seeds over the top if using.
07 - Bake for 35 to 40 minutes until the top is gol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out mostly clean.
08 - Let the bake cool for 10 minutes before slicing into squares. Serve warm or at room temperature.

02 -
  • Protein powder can make baked goods dry if you overbake, so start checking at the 30-minute mark
  • Letting it cool completely before storing prevents that soggy bottom situation in the fridge
03 -
  • Mash your bananas really well—chunks can create uneven texture in the final bake
  • If your protein powder is sweetened, reduce the honey to 1/4 cup to avoid it being too sweet
